Common House Settling Repair Jobs
House settling repairs - address uneven floors and cracks caused by shifting foundations.
Foundation stabilization - reinforce and support settling foundations to prevent further movement.
Crack repair services - seal and fill cracks in walls and ceilings resulting from settling issues.
Pier and beam adjustments - realign and stabilize piers and beams affected by soil movement.
Soil and ground assessment - evaluate soil conditions to determine the best repair approach.
Structural reinforcement - strengthen compromised areas to restore home stability and safety.
House Settling Repair Questions
What causes house settling issues? House settling can result from soil movement, moisture changes, or foundation shifts over time, leading to uneven floors and cracks.
What signs indicate the need for settling repair? Common signs include cracked walls, uneven flooring,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around moldings.
What types of settling repair services are available? Services typically include foundation stabilization, mudjacking, piering, and crack repair to restore stability.
How can settling problems affect a property? Settling can cause structural damage, reduce property value, and lead to costly repairs if not addressed promptly.
